Today on Franchise Maven, we take a dive into the publishing world and debunk the myth that you can’t write a book because your English teacher said you were terrible at it in school–or even if you just write poorly. Guest Rob Kosberg joins host Greg Mohr to introduce Bestseller Publishing’s unique program involving ghostwriters, a TED talk-type format, and narrowing your hook with the goal to get CLIENTS, not cash, as your profit.
3 Key Takeaways
- You don’t need to sell a million copies of your book to profit from it. Just don’t expect royalties to be the primary source of profit.
- Just because you were told you can’t write in high school, doesn’t mean you aren’t equipped to write a book. Rob’s program only requires you to talk about what you know.
- The biggest book mistake is a broad application–NARROW your hook!

About Rob Kosberg
Rob Kosberg is founder of Best Seller Publishing, where he specializes in helping their clients become the “go-to” experts in their fields by developing the “right” book to give to people they want to work with, then promoting that book to bestseller status, and finally, booking them on TV, radio & podcasts. He is a published, best-selling author, himself, and currently acts as host for his podcast: Publish. Promote. Profit.
